The Child's True Christian Religion is a religious book written by Thomas Hitchcock and first published in 1869. The book is intended for children and aims to teach them about the fundamental principles of Christianity. It covers a range of topics related to Christianity, including the nature of God, the importance of prayer, and the role of Jesus Christ in salvation. The book is written in a simple and accessible style, making it easy for children to understand. Hitchcock also includes stories and parables to illustrate key points and make the material more engaging.
